NVIDIA GeForce GTX 750 Ti vs AMD Radeon RX 9070 XT

We compared two Desktop platform GPUs: 2GB VRAM GeForce GTX 750 Ti and 16GB VRAM Radeon RX 9070 XT to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

NVIDIA GeForce GTX 750 Ti 's Advantages
Lower TDP (60W vs 304W)
AMD Radeon RX 9070 XT 's Advantages
Released 11 years and 1 months late
Boost Clock has increased by 174% (2970MHz vs 1085MHz)
More VRAM (16GB vs 2GB)
Larger VRAM bandwidth (644.6GB/s vs 86.40GB/s)
3456 additional rendering cores
